
Oakley CHL Player/Goaltender of the Week Winners Announced
February 2, 2009 - Central Hockey League (CHL) News Release
The Central Hockey League announced today that the recipients for the Oakley CHL Player and Goaltender of the Week for the period ending Feb 1st, 2009 are forward Adam Perry of the Arizona Sundogs and Ken Carroll of the Bossier-Shreveport Mudbugs.
Perry had points in each of the Sundogs three games last week helping the defending champs to a 2-1-0 record. The Peterborough, Ontario native finished the week with five goals and three assists while posting a +4 plus/minus rating. Perry's five goals came on a thrifty eight shots on goal. His best game of the week came during Wednesday's 4-1 victory over Rocky Mountain where he had a hand in each Sundog goal netting a hat trick with an assist. For the season, the Phoenix Coyotes assigned player has 45 points (18-27=45) in 31 games. The 5-11, 185-pound forward has played in eight American Hockey League games with San Antonio notching one assist.
Carroll has been one of the hottest goaltenders in the league over the past two months and is coming off a week that saw him win all three starts last week. The veteran netminder finished the week with maybe his best performance stopping 44 of 46 shots versus Rapid City. Earlier in the week, the Oil City, Ontario native made 39 saves in a 2-1 victory over Mississippi in what at the time was a battle for first place in the Northeast Division. On the season, Carroll has bounced back from an injury-plagued start boasting a 15-5-2 record with a 2.47 goals against average and a .926 save percentage.
In recognition of their achievement, both Perry and Carroll will receive a special gift from Oakley.
